#b35bf2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b35bf2 is composed of 70.2% red, 35.7%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26% cyan, 62.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 275 degrees, a saturation of 85.3% and a lightness of 65.3%. #b35bf2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b6ff with #6700e5.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

Shades and Tints of #b35bf2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0112 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b35bf2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a7a6a7 is the less saturated color, while #b454f9 is the most saturated one.
